Maternity den
A lair for birth and early nurturing of young.
A maternity den is a lair where a mother animal gives birth and nurtures her young when they are in a vulnerable life stage. Dens are typically subterranean, but may also be snow caves or beneath rock ledges. Characteristically, a maternity den has an entrance, optionally an exit corridor, and a principal chamber.

Lore & Background
The polar bear creates a maternity den either in an earthen subterranean or in a snow cave. On the Hudson Bay Plain in Manitoba, Canada, many subterranean dens are situated in the Wapusk National Park. Pregnant female polar bears begin looking for a maternity den when other bears head to the ocean; the den is usually in a snow bank or along an ice patch of ocean shore. The female digs her own den and enters a hibernation-like state, not eating, drinking, or defecating while inside, and gives birth to her cubs there.
Reader's Guide
The maternity den is a critical structure for several species, providing a protected space for birth and early development. For polar bears, the den is the shelter for most of the winter, and the female's ability to have fed sufficiently before entering is essential due to the scarcity of food on land. In African wild dogs, pack members may guard the maternity den used by the alpha female. The brown hyena uses dens located in coastal or inland regions, often caverns with narrow entrances, and stores bones within or around the entrance. The red fox creates dens after mating, often enlarging an old woodchuck burrow or using a hollow log, streambank, rock pile, cave, or dense shrub; the den is chosen on raised ground for visibility, with a main entrance about three feet wide and one or two escape holes, lined with grass and dry leaves. These examples illustrate the variety of forms and functions of maternity dens across species.

The Winter Shelter Where Life Begins
The maternity den stands as the single most critical structure in a polar bear's annual cycle. During the harsh Arctic winter, the mother retreats to this shelter to give birth to her cubs, a period when the surrounding landscape is dominated by sea ice and extreme cold. As a species that is both terrestrial and ice-dependent—classified as a marine mammal due to its reliance on marine ecosystems—the polar bear's need for a secure land-based refuge during this reproductive window is essential. The den provides a protected space where the newborn cubs, born small and vulnerable, can develop in the warmth of their mother's thick layer of fat and fur. This period of denning occurs when the bear is not actively hunting seals on the ice, making the den a vital survival structure that bridges the gap between the ice-based hunting season and the eventual return to the sea. The solitary nature of polar bears means that this den represents a period of complete isolation, where the mother and her newborns are cut off from the wider population.
The Long Maternal Investment
The maternity den marks the beginning of what becomes one of the longest maternal care periods in the bear family. Cubs born within the den remain with their mother for up to two and a half years, a span that far exceeds the weaning periods seen in many other large mammals. This extended dependency is made possible by the mother's ability to sustain her young through her own energy reserves, including the thick layer of fat that characterizes the species. The sexual dimorphism of the polar bear—where adult females are significantly smaller than males—means that the mother operates with a comparatively smaller body while still providing for her offspring over this prolonged period. During the denning phase, the mother and cubs are entirely isolated from the rest of the population, as polar bears are typically solitary animals. It is only after the cubs emerge from the den and begin to grow that they may occasionally be encountered in small groups on land, though the primary social unit remains the mother and her young.

A Cycle Under Threat
The maternity den cycle, once a reliable feature of the Arctic winter, now faces mounting pressure from environmental change. The IUCN classifies the polar bear as a vulnerable species, with an estimated population of 22,000 to 31,000 individuals, and the primary threats—climate change, pollution, and energy development—directly undermine the conditions that make denning possible. As sea ice declines, polar bears are forced to spend more time on land, which disrupts their access to the energy-rich seal blubber they depend on for survival. A mother bear that cannot build sufficient fat reserves before entering her den faces a far more dangerous winter for herself and her cubs. The increased time spent on land also elevates the risk of conflicts with humans, potentially threatening the security of denning sites. What was once a stable, isolated period of birth and early development is now a cycle increasingly vulnerable to the same forces that are reshaping the Arctic landscape.
Frequently Asked Questions
What is a maternity den in animal biology?
A maternity den is a sheltered space where a mother animal gives birth and cares for her offspring during their most vulnerable early life stage. It serves as a protected lair specifically dedicated to birth and initial nurturing rather than general daytime resting.
Where are maternity dens typically found?
They are most often subterranean, dug into the ground, but can also take the form of snow caves or spaces tucked beneath rock ledges. The common thread is that the location offers natural concealment and insulation for the newborn young.
Which animals are known to use maternity dens?
Polar bears, African wild dogs, brown hyenas, and red foxes are all well-documented users of maternity dens. Each species adapts the den's construction to its environment, but the core purpose of sheltering newborns remains the same.
What structural features define a maternity den?
A maternity den characteristically includes an entrance, a principal chamber where the mother and young stay, and optionally a separate exit corridor. This layout allows the mother to move in and out while keeping the vulnerable young tucked away in the main room.
Why is the maternity den important for offspring survival?
It provides a confined, defensible space that shields helpless newborns from predators and harsh weather during the period when they cannot yet flee or regulate their own body temperature. Without this dedicated shelter, the survival rate of young in many of these species would drop significantly.
